added "install" instruction
[Leditor.git] / src / lqt_bind_QObject.hpp
blobd349b7a20b2d28372178d08c6d7b2c02f7be8c13
1 #include "lqt_common.hpp"
2 #include <QObject>
3 #include <QtCore>
4 #include <QtGui>
6 template <> class LuaBinder< QObject > : public QObject {
7 private:
8 lua_State *L;
9 public:
10 static int __LuaWrapCall__parent (lua_State *L);
11 static int __LuaWrapCall__signalsBlocked (lua_State *L);
12 static int __LuaWrapCall__trUtf8__OverloadedVersion__1 (lua_State *L);
13 static int __LuaWrapCall__trUtf8__OverloadedVersion__2 (lua_State *L);
14 static int __LuaWrapCall__trUtf8 (lua_State *L);
15 static int __LuaWrapCall__killTimer (lua_State *L);
16 static int __LuaWrapCall__dumpObjectTree (lua_State *L);
17 static int __LuaWrapCall__dumpObjectInfo (lua_State *L);
18 static int __LuaWrapCall__event (lua_State *L);
19 static int __LuaWrapCall__installEventFilter (lua_State *L);
20 static int __LuaWrapCall__inherits (lua_State *L);
21 static int __LuaWrapCall__registerUserData (lua_State *L);
22 static int __LuaWrapCall__dynamicPropertyNames (lua_State *L);
23 static int __LuaWrapCall__connect__OverloadedVersion__1 (lua_State *L);
24 static int __LuaWrapCall__connect__OverloadedVersion__2 (lua_State *L);
25 static int __LuaWrapCall__connect (lua_State *L);
26 static int __LuaWrapCall__setObjectName (lua_State *L);
27 static int __LuaWrapCall__isWidgetType (lua_State *L);
28 static int __LuaWrapCall__property (lua_State *L);
29 static int __LuaWrapCall__children (lua_State *L);
30 static int __LuaWrapCall__new (lua_State *L);
31 static int __LuaWrapCall__delete (lua_State *L);
32 static int __LuaWrapCall__setUserData (lua_State *L);
33 static int __LuaWrapCall__eventFilter (lua_State *L);
34 static int __LuaWrapCall__userData (lua_State *L);
35 static int __LuaWrapCall__startTimer (lua_State *L);
36 static int __LuaWrapCall__moveToThread (lua_State *L);
37 static int __LuaWrapCall__thread (lua_State *L);
38 static int __LuaWrapCall__blockSignals (lua_State *L);
39 static int __LuaWrapCall__tr__OverloadedVersion__1 (lua_State *L);
40 static int __LuaWrapCall__tr__OverloadedVersion__2 (lua_State *L);
41 static int __LuaWrapCall__tr (lua_State *L);
42 static int __LuaWrapCall__setParent (lua_State *L);
43 static int __LuaWrapCall__disconnect__OverloadedVersion__1 (lua_State *L);
44 static int __LuaWrapCall__disconnect__OverloadedVersion__2 (lua_State *L);
45 static int __LuaWrapCall__disconnect__OverloadedVersion__3 (lua_State *L);
46 static int __LuaWrapCall__disconnect (lua_State *L);
47 static int __LuaWrapCall__removeEventFilter (lua_State *L);
48 static int __LuaWrapCall__deleteLater (lua_State *L);
49 static int __LuaWrapCall__metaObject (lua_State *L);
50 static int __LuaWrapCall__setProperty (lua_State *L);
51 static int __LuaWrapCall__objectName (lua_State *L);
52 bool event (QEvent * arg1);
53 protected:
54 void disconnectNotify (const char * arg1);
55 public:
56 bool eventFilter (QObject * arg1, QEvent * arg2);
57 protected:
58 void timerEvent (QTimerEvent * arg1);
59 public:
60 protected:
61 void connectNotify (const char * arg1);
62 public:
63 protected:
64 void childEvent (QChildEvent * arg1);
65 public:
66 const QMetaObject * metaObject () const;
67 protected:
68 void customEvent (QEvent * arg1);
69 public:
70 ~LuaBinder< QObject > ();
71 LuaBinder< QObject > (lua_State *l, QObject * arg1):QObject(arg1), L(l) {}
74 extern "C" int luaopen_QObject (lua_State *L);